7 Considerations For Enrolling in Violin Course

Your goals and expectations

The first thing you need to consider is your goals and expectations. Do you want to learn the violin for fun or to pursue a career as a professional musician? Are you looking for a structured course with regular assignments and feedback, or do you prefer a more flexible learning environment? This will help you choose a course that aligns with your needs and preferences.

The course content

The next thing you should consider is the course content. What topics will be covered? Will the course cover the basics of playing the violin, or will it delve into advanced techniques? Is the course suitable for beginners, or is it geared towards more experienced players? Make sure you understand the course content before enrolling, so you can choose a course that is appropriate for your skill level and interests.

The instructor’s qualifications

The instructor’s qualifications are another critical factor to consider. Is the instructor a professional musician with years of experience, or are they a beginner themselves? What is their teaching philosophy? A qualified and experienced instructor can make a significant difference in your learning journey, so make sure you research their qualifications before enrolling.

The course structure

The course structure is another essential factor to consider. Is the course self-paced, or does it have a fixed schedule? Will you have access to live classes or pre-recorded lessons? How often will you receive feedback on your progress? Understanding the course structure will help you determine if it is a good fit for your learning style and schedule.

The course format

The course format is also crucial. Will the course be conducted online, in-person, or a combination of both? What technology or equipment do you need to participate? Make sure you understand the course format before enrolling so that you can prepare accordingly.

The cost

The cost of the course is another factor to consider. How much does the course cost, and what is included in the price? Will you need to purchase additional materials or equipment? Are there any discounts or scholarships available? Make sure you understand the cost of the course before enrolling, so you can budget accordingly.

The time commitment

Finally, you should consider the time commitment required for the course. Will you need to practice outside of class? Understanding the time commitment required will help you determine if the course is feasible for your schedule and lifestyle.
